What exactly is fill dirt and how is it different from topsoil in Grove City, FL?
Fill dirt is subsoil used to raise or level ground; it contains little organic matter and is mainly sand, silt, and clay. In Grove City and West Florida, native soils tend to be sandy with occasional clay pockets, so fill dirt is best used for building up grades or under paved areas rather than for planting.

How many cubic yards are in a typical dump truck load delivered to Grove City?
Most tri-axle dump trucks used by local haulers carry about 10 to 12 cubic yards of loose fill dirt. Some larger trucks can carry more, so confirm truck size when you order if you need an exact quantity.
How much fill dirt do I need to raise an area by a certain depth?
Use this quick calculation: cubic yards = (square feet x depth in inches) / 324. For example, raising 1,000 sq ft by 4 inches requires about 12.3 cubic yards; allow 5% to 10% extra for compaction and settlement.
Will 1 cubic yard of fill dirt fit in a pickup truck in Grove City?
Yes, one cubic yard is roughly the amount that fits in a standard pickup bed when loaded to just above the bed, though it may extend over the tailgate. Be careful of payload weight limits and local road/load laws; securing the load is required for safe transport.
What does 1 cubic yard of fill dirt look like in practical terms?
One cubic yard equals 27 cubic feet, roughly a wheelbarrow 20 to 30 times over or about one full tri-axle truck divided by 10 to 12. Visually, it will cover about 81 sq ft at 4 inches deep or 162 sq ft at 2 inches deep.
How much area will fill dirt cover at common depths?
Because 1 cubic yard is 27 cubic feet, it covers about 81 sq ft at 4 inches, 162 sq ft at 2 inches, and 324 sq ft at 1 inch. Always calculate using your exact dimensions and add 5% to 10% for settling and compaction.
Is fill dirt cheaper than gravel in Grove City?
Generally yes—fill dirt is usually less expensive than construction-grade gravel because it is unprocessed subsoil. However, final cost depends on delivery distance, truck size, and whether you need compacted or engineered fill.
Can I use fill dirt for a driveway or to stabilize a base?
Fill dirt alone is not a good finished surface for driveways because it compacts and can rut when wet. For a driveway in Grove City, put fill dirt only as needed to raise grade, then add a compacted gravel base and a surface layer suitable for vehicle traffic.
Do I need to compact fill dirt in West Florida and how should it be done?
Yes, compaction is important in West Florida due to seasonal rains that can cause settlement. Place fill dirt in lifts (commonly 4 to 6 inches), compact each lift with appropriate equipment, and consider geotextile fabric if soils are very sandy or soft.
Will fill dirt settle over time in Grove City and how much should I allow for?
Expect some settlement after placement—commonly 5% to 15% depending on the existing soil, moisture, and compaction method. To avoid low spots, order extra material and ensure proper compaction during installation.
Do I need permits to bring in or place fill dirt in Grove City, FL?
Rules can vary by property and project type; changes to grade, blocking drainage, or raising elevations may require permits or county approval. Check with Charlotte County building and environmental departments before placing large amounts of fill dirt.
